Christopher Atkins says drinking cost him role in 'Footloose
At the Fanboy Expo Knoxville in Tennessee, 65‑year‑old actor Christopher Atkins told a panel that his heavy drinking in the early 1980s caused him to miss a crucial meeting with the producers of the 1984 film *Footloose*. He recalled, “I was a mess back then… I can’t go in right now, I’ve been drinking and carrying on,” and said he blew the audition, after which the lead went to Kevin Bacon.
Atkins, who rose to fame with *The Blue Lagoon* in 1980, said he is now almost 40 years sober and reflected on how the missed *Footloose* role could have altered his career, noting the part launched Kevin Bacon’s stardom.
